Falesa - Girl Name Meaning and Pronunciation

Falesa

Falesa is a unique and melodious name with a rich cultural background. It is often considered to mean 'a dwelling or home' in the Samoan language, conveying a sense of warmth, comfort, and belonging. The name is predominantly feminine and is used in various cultures across the Pacific Islands.

Falesa is embraced for its gentle sound and positive connotations, often associated with nurturing and family. It is easy to write and pronounce, making it a favorable choice for many parents looking for a distinctive yet inviting name.
